Dating midterms
May 13, 2010
Am I the only one who finds the distinction between "short-term" and "long-term" dating on the interests checklist simply bizarre? My casual observation is that 99% of profiles check both or neither. Probably more nines than that, actually.
I mean, what, you're going to specify? "I'd like to date, but only if you can promise that you are(n't) going to dig me enough to maintain a relationship for N months, up front." Bweh? The long-term only option is particularly weird. How would you figure _that_ was going to work?
"Look, I'm sorry, this isn't working out, it's not you, it's me."
"Suck it up, buttercup, you signed up for long-term. Or don't you *remember the contract*?"
"Whoops, forgot about that. *My bad*. So...how's Italian sound tonight?"
